#dca491 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#dca491 is composed of 86.3% red, 64.3% green and 56.9%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 25.5% magenta, 34.1% yellow and 13.7% black. It has a hue angle of 15.2 degrees, a saturation of 51.7% and a lightness of 71.6%. #dca491 color hex could be obtained by blending #ffffff with #b94923. Closest websafe color is: #cc9999.

#dca491 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#dca491 has RGB values of R:220, G:164, B:145 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.25, Y:0.34, K:0.14. Its decimal value is 14460049.

Shades and Tints of #dca491
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#090403 is the darkest color, while #fdfaf9 is the lightest one.

Tones of #dca491
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#bbb5b2 is the less saturated color, while #fd9370 is the most saturated one.
